How to Write a Mother’s Day Ring Gift Message

Start with the relationship, then name what the ring represents. Mother’s Day gives the card its occasion, but the ring needs a more personal reason.

  1. Decide who the message is from: daughter, son, husband, children, grandchildren, or the whole family.
  2. Name the ring type: birthstone, mother’s ring, family ring, diamond ring, stackable band, engraved ring, or heirloom-style gift.
  3. Choose one emotional angle: gratitude, motherhood, family, memory, strength, tenderness, legacy, or new-mom love.
  4. Add one detail that belongs only to her: a child’s name, birth month, family phrase, or shared memory.

What to Avoid in a Mother’s Day Ring Card

Do not let the card become a plain “Happy Mother’s Day” line if the gift is a meaningful ring. That works for flowers. Jewelry needs a sentence that explains why the ring matters.

Also avoid making the message too formal if the recipient is your wife or mom. A beautiful ring can handle a warm sentence. In fact, it usually needs one.
